The cheapest way to get from Sheridan to Albany is to drive which costs $7 - $12 and takes 1h.
The fastest way to get from Sheridan to Albany is to drive which takes 1h and costs $7 - $12.
No, there is no direct bus from Sheridan to Albany station. However, there are services departing from Sheridan - EB Main St & Washington and arriving at Albany Amtrak Station via McMinnville and Downtown Transit Center.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 45m.
The distance between Sheridan and Albany is 75 miles. The road distance is 43.3 miles.
The best way to get from Sheridan to Albany without a car is to bus which takes 3h 45m and costs $5 - $22.
It takes approximately 3h 45m to get from Sheridan to Albany, including transfers.
Sheridan to Albany bus services, operated by Pacific Crest Buslines Bend, depart from McMinnville station.
Sheridan to Albany bus services, operated by Pacific Crest Buslines Bend, arrive at Corvallis Downtown station.
Yes, the driving distance between Sheridan to Albany is 43 miles. It takes approximately 1h to drive from Sheridan to Albany.
